As with two-dimensional nuclear magnetic resonance (2DNMR) spectroscopy, This system spreads the spectrum in two dimensions and permits the observation of cross peaks that incorporate info on the coupling between unique modes. In distinction to 2DNMR, nonlinear two-dimensional infrared spectroscopy also entails the excitation to overtones. These excitations cause thrilled point out absorption peaks Situated beneath the diagonal and cross peaks. In 2DNMR, two distinct procedures, COSY and NOESY, are regularly applied. The cross peaks in the very first are related to the scalar coupling, while while in the latter They're connected with the spin transfer amongst diverse nuclei.
